10th Recycling Campaign - A RECORD BREAKER

03.07.2010

10th Recycling Campaign - A RECORD BREAKER

On 19th June 2010 (Sat), we have had a JUMBO collection.

In total, we have received an amount of more than 800kgs of old newspaper. The takings from this 10th Session was RM 381/=, one of our highest.


Special for this session, volunteers set up Buntings at several strategic locations around our neighborhood. The Buntings were donated by a volunteer committee member.

Project - 6th, 7th and 8th Recycling for Sinking Funds

Date: 24.04.2010

Project - 6th, 7th and 8th Recycling for Sinking Funds

Month by month volunteers and supporters have been contributing old news papers for our recycling project.

These funds have been gradually accumulating giving us a sustainable income that could help to support the upkeep of facilities and activities in our neighborhood.

Session 6th and 7th was a true record breaker. We have had the largest collection ever received. Session 7 alone itself, we have collected an amount of more than RM 300/= .

Session 8th was a bit slow. Here are some pictures of collections received that day (17th Apr 2010, Saturday).
